Claims (2)
- 다음 구조식(Ⅱ) 또는 (Ⅲ)로 표시되는 유기용매에 아미노페놀 유도체를 상기 유기용매에 대해 15 내지 35중량%를 용해시킨 후 알칼리염을 아미노페놀 몰수의 1.1 내지 2.0몰배가 되도록 첨가시키고 CO2가스압력을 1내지 8기압으로 유지하면서 50 내지 150℃의 온도에서 4 내지 7시간 반응시켜서 됨을 특징으로 하는 다음 구조식(Ⅰ)로 표시되는 살리실산 유도체의 제조방법.상기식에서, R1은 3-NH2, 4-NH2, 5-NH2이고, R2는 수소원자, 탄소수가 1내지 18인 알킬기, 비닐기 또는 페닐기를 나타낸다.상기식에서, R은 1 내지 3의 탄소원자를 갖는 알킬기이고, X는 -O- 또는 -S- 이며, Y는 -OH 또는 -NH2이고, n은 1 내지 3의 정수이며, m은 0 내지 2의 정수이다.
- 제1항에 있어서, 유기용매는 프로필렌 글리콜 모노메틸 에테르, 에틸렌 글리콜 모노메틸 에테르, 3-메톡시-1-부탄올임을 특징으로 하는 살리실산 유도체의 제조방법.※ 참고사항 : 최초출원 내용에 의하여 공개하는 것임.
